What are the solar terms in a year?
Beginning of spring, rain, fright, vernal equinox, Qingming, Grain Rain;
Long summer, Xiaoman, Mangzhong, Summer Solstice, Xiaoshu, Dashu;
Beginning of autumn, Chu Shu, Bailu, Autumnal Equinox, Cold Dew, First Frost;
Beginning of winter, light snow, heavy snow. Winter solstice, slight cold, severe cold
